When parenting transforms your relationship into a logistical struggle, a structured weekly check-in can bring you back together. Sophie discusses how the routine of checking in can shift you from survival mode to feeling like a team again. This mini-podcast dives into the importance of predictability and emotional safety that these sessions can create.
Three ideas to start your check-in
- Begin with two specific appreciations for your partner.
- Use the 'Radical Responsibility' formula to address conflict: 'I felt [emotion] when [action], and what I need is [action].'
- Finish by planning the week, including solo-time for each partner.
